Gdansk grosz, Sigismund I the Old (King of Poland; 1506–1548). Silver coin (1531). Obverse: Crowned male bust in profile turned to the right; rim inscription between pearl-shaped borders: .SIGIS.I.REX.POOCI. Reverse: Coat of arms of Gdansk; rim inscription between pearl-shaped borders: .GROSSVS.DAN. Date: 1531. Poland, Gdansk. Style: Jagiellon period; iconography: royal/male busts, city coat of arms.
